Block

#21,604,371
Block Number
21,604,371 @ 05/06/2025, 23:07:50
Status
Finalized
ID
0x0149a8136c88b8b62bd2d5eff9947f0adf78c5a397727e5ea5b8f2239def6be1
Transactions
Gas Used
2299011/40000000 (5.75% Used)
Total Score
2,109,850,053 (+99)
Rewards
8.58 VTHO